Mastering the NAS System: A Comprehensive Guide to Network-Attached Storage

In today’s digital world, efficient data storage is crucial for both individuals and businesses alike. From storing personal photos to managing vast amounts of enterprise data, the need for reliable storage solutions has never been greater. One such solution that has gained immense popularity is Network-Attached Storage (NAS). This guide will take you through everything you need to know about NAS systems, from their evolution to best practices for implementation.

What is Network-Attached Storage (NAS)?

Network-Attached Storage (NAS) is a dedicated file storage system that allows multiple users and heterogeneous client devices to retrieve data from a centralized disk capacity. NAS systems provide a simple and cost-effective way to store and share files across a network, making them an ideal solution for both home and enterprise environments.

NAS devices are connected to a network via Ethernet and are assigned an IP address, allowing users to access files over the network rather than through a direct connection. This network-based approach offers significant advantages, such as centralized management, easier file sharing, and enhanced data security.

The Evolution of NAS

NAS technology has come a long way since its inception. Initially designed for personal use, early NAS devices were simple and affordable, offering basic file storage and sharing capabilities. These early models were perfect for home users who needed a centralized location to store family photos, music collections, and other personal files.

However, as data storage needs grew, so did the capabilities of NAS systems. Today, NAS solutions have evolved to meet the demands of businesses, offering advanced features such as data redundancy, scalability, and robust security measures. Modern NAS system can handle large volumes of data, making them suitable for enterprises with complex storage requirements.

The introduction of scale-out NAS systems has further revolutionized the industry. These systems allow businesses to expand their storage capacity seamlessly by adding additional nodes, ensuring that they can keep up with growing data demands without significant disruptions.

Understanding Scale-Out NAS: Benefits and Use Cases

Scale-out NAS systems are designed to provide scalable storage solutions for organizations with rapidly growing data needs. Unlike traditional NAS systems, which have fixed storage capacities, scale-out NAS allows businesses to add more storage nodes as needed, ensuring that they can grow their storage infrastructure in line with their data requirements.

Benefits of Scale-Out NAS

  1. Scalability: One of the primary benefits of scale-out NAS is its scalability. Businesses can start with a small storage setup and expand as their data needs increase, avoiding the need for costly and disruptive migrations.
  2. High Availability: Scale-out NAS systems are designed to offer high availability and redundancy. Data is distributed across multiple nodes, ensuring that there is no single point of failure. This architecture enhances data reliability and minimizes downtime.
  3. Performance: With scale-out NAS, businesses can achieve high performance by distributing workloads across multiple nodes. This parallel processing capability ensures that data access remains fast and efficient, even as data volumes grow.

Use Cases for Scale-Out NAS

Scale-out NAS systems are ideal for a wide range of applications, including:

  1. Big Data Analytics: Organizations dealing with large datasets can benefit from the scalability and performance of scale-out NAS, enabling them to analyze data efficiently.
  2. Media and Entertainment: Media companies often require vast amounts of storage for high-resolution video files. Scale-out NAS provides the required storage capacity and performance for media production and distribution.
  3. Backup and Archiving: Businesses can use scale-out NAS systems to store backup copies of their data, ensuring that critical information is protected and easily retrievable.

How to Choose the Right Scale-Out NAS for Your Business?

Selecting the right scale-out NAS system for your business requires careful consideration of several factors. Here are some key aspects to keep in mind:

Storage Capacity

Assess your current and future storage needs to determine the required capacity. Consider the types of data you will be storing and whether you anticipate significant growth in data volumes. Opt for a system that can scale to meet your long-term storage requirements.

Performance Requirements

Evaluate the performance capabilities of different NAS systems. Look for solutions that offer high-speed data access, especially if you have applications that require low-latency storage. Consider factors such as IOPS (Input/Output Operations Per Second) and throughput to ensure optimal performance.

Data Protection and Security

Data security is paramount for any business. Choose a NAS system that offers robust data protection features, such as RAID (Redundant Array of Independent Disks) configurations, encryption, and access controls. Additionally, consider solutions that provide automated backup and disaster recovery options.

Integration and Compatibility

Ensure that the NAS system you choose is compatible with your existing IT infrastructure. Look for solutions that support seamless integration with your current hardware and software, allowing for smooth deployment and management.

Cost Considerations

While scale-out NAS systems can be cost-effective in the long run, initial costs can vary. Evaluate the total cost of ownership, including hardware, software, and ongoing maintenance expenses. Consider solutions that offer flexible pricing models to suit your budget.

Best Practices for Implementing and Managing a Scale-Out NAS

Implementing a scale-out NAS system requires careful planning and execution to ensure optimal performance and reliability. Here are some best practices to follow:

Plan for Scalability

When deploying a scale-out NAS storage, plan for future scalability from the outset. Design your storage architecture to accommodate additional nodes without major disruptions. This forward-thinking approach will save you time and resources as your storage needs grow.

Monitor Performance and Utilization

Regularly monitor the performance and utilization of your NAS system. Use monitoring tools to track metrics such as CPU usage, memory consumption, and network traffic. This proactive approach helps identify potential bottlenecks and ensures that your system operates efficiently.

Implement Data Protection Measures

Data protection should be a top priority. Configure RAID levels to provide redundancy and protect against disk failures. Implement regular backup schedules to safeguard your data and ensure that you can recover quickly in the event of a disaster.

Optimize Network Configuration

The performance of your NAS system is closely tied to your network infrastructure. Ensure that your network is optimized for high-speed data transfer. Use dedicated network interfaces for NAS traffic and consider implementing link aggregation to enhance network performance and reliability.

Keep Software and Firmware Updated

Regularly update the software and firmware of your NAS system to benefit from the latest features and security patches. Keeping your system up to date helps protect against vulnerabilities and ensures that you have access to the latest improvements.

The Future of NAS Technology

The future of NAS technology looks promising, with several trends and advancements on the horizon. Here are some developments to watch out for:

Integration with Cloud Services

Hybrid NAS solutions that integrate with cloud services are becoming increasingly popular. These systems allow businesses to leverage the scalability and flexibility of the cloud while maintaining control over their on-premises data.

AI and Machine Learning

AI and machine learning are set to revolutionize NAS systems. These technologies can enhance data management, improve predictive analytics, and optimize storage utilization. AI-powered NAS systems can automatically classify and organize data, making it easier to access and manage.

Enhanced Security Features

Security will continue to be a top priority for NAS technology. Future NAS systems are expected to incorporate advanced security features such as AI-driven threat detection, blockchain-based data integrity, and enhanced encryption techniques to protect against evolving cyber threats.

Increased Focus on Sustainability

Sustainability is becoming a key consideration in technology development. NAS manufacturers are likely to focus on creating energy-efficient systems that reduce power consumption and minimize environmental impact. This shift towards sustainability aligns with broader corporate social responsibility goals.

Conclusion and Key Takeaways

Network-Attached Storage (NAS) systems have evolved from simple home solutions to powerful enterprise-grade storage platforms. Scale-out storage NAS, in particular, offers unparalleled scalability, high availability, and performance, making it an ideal choice for businesses with growing data needs.

By understanding the benefits and use cases of scale-out NAS, selecting the right system for your business, and following best practices for implementation and management, you can harness the full potential of this technology. Keep an eye on future developments in NAS technology to stay ahead of the curve and ensure that your storage infrastructure remains robust and efficient.